One quiet afternoon during junior high school, while walking home, I saw several people sitting by the roadside who appeared to have no place to live. I wanted to help them, but I knew I was also living modestly with my grandfather after my parents divorced. The only thing I could offer was the leftover money I had. In that quiet moment, a question arose in my heart: "Could I help them by providing a chance to earn a living on their own?" That simple question has never left me and became a small spark that continues to guide my life's purpose to this day. Since then, I have seen education not merely as an obligation, but as a powerful tool to create meaningful change for myself and those in hardship.
Growing up in a modest household, I learned early on to be independent and to persevere in my education despite financial challenges. I have always strived to excel both academically and in character. In junior high school, I balanced academics with playing basketball. In senior high school, I joined the student council (OSIS) and the English club, serving as secretary, event coordinator, and division member. These roles sharpened my leadership, responsibility, and teamwork. I also joined a student changemaker community, where I participated in discussions and activities promoting positive change among youth. These experiences shaped me into an active learner who remains focused on academic goals while staying socially engaged. I earned the JAWARA Scholarship from PT Pupuk Kujang, the Karawang Cerdas Scholarship, and an award in an English competition. I have also been learning Korean on my own because I am genuinely interested in the language and culture. Even though I am still at a basic level, I believe understanding the language will help me adapt more easily and connect with people around me. These experiences taught me that success is not only about results, but also about perseverance, integrity, and the belief that small steps lead to meaningful impact. I aim not only to succeed, but to help others rise with me.
This purpose led me to seek a higher education opportunity that aligns with both my personal values and professional aspirations. I actively explored scholarship opportunities and found the Global Korea Scholarship (GKS). This program embodies values I deeply respect: perseverance, hard work, and global vision. South Korea's ability to harmonize innovation and cultural identity aligns with my ambition to build a technology-based business that improves daily life efficiency and empowers communities. My focus is on digital tools and household technologies that simplify routines while creating employment. I hope to connect innovation with social impact by offering training programs and job opportunities, especially for those facing unemployment or homelessness. In Indonesia, rapid urbanization has not been matched by inclusive job opportunities, particularly for individuals over 30 who have limited access to formal education or digital tools. To ensure real impact, I will offer structured training for new employees to help them understand their responsibilities and develop confidence in their abilities. The program will focus on building basic practical skills, especially for those who previously had limited access to education or job experience. By doing this, I hope to reduce unemployment caused by lack of skills and contribute to poverty reduction through long-term, inclusive job opportunities.
My interest in business began when my family's financial situation worsened during the pandemic. I worked part-time at a doll factory during junior high school and saw how businesses affect both consumers and workers. I realized that well-run businesses can improve lives. This experience inspired me to take business seriously and explore strategy, management, and decision-making. With a degree in Business Administration, I hope to gain the knowledge to build a business that is both financially sustainable and socially impactful.
I chose Keimyung University because its College of Business Administration offers a global, practical curriculum. The program emphasizes leadership and entrepreneurship, supported by industry partnerships and internships. With collaborations across 240 universities in 43 countries and exchange opportunities through the International Student Exchange Program (ISEP), Keimyung offers a multicultural learning experience. Its Seongseo Campus blends modern learning with cultural heritage, and services like the International Student Services Center and International Lounge create a welcoming environment. The university's mission to foster ethical global leaders aligns perfectly with my vision of building a business that brings lasting, inclusive progress.
Through the Global Korea Scholarship and an education at Keimyung University, I see a path to becoming a capable individual, equipped for global business challenges. I hope to gain hands-on experience in South Korea, learn directly from its industries, and return to Indonesia to build a business that empowers marginalized communities. My business will provide not only jobs but also training, enabling those previously unskilled to gain confidence and economic independence. Over time, this can reduce poverty and unemployment in underserved areas. For me, education is not merely a route to personal success, but a responsibility to initiate change. GKS and Keimyung University are not only bridges to my dreams, but also the foundation for a life dedicated to uplifting others. Just as one quiet moment sparked my dream, I hope my journey through GKS and Keimyung University will become a beacon of hope for others still waiting for their own opportunity to rise.
